Schools & Education
Families in Vance are served by the Boyd County Public School District, a system known for its commitment to student growth and community involvement. Students typically attend specific Boyd County schools based on their precise location within the Vance area, with many zoned for Hager Elementary School, which feeds into Boyd County Middle and Boyd County High School. These schools offer a range of academic programs, extracurricular activities, and athletic teams.
For higher education and specialized learning, the area is rich with options. Ashland Community and Technical College (ACTC) is minutes away, providing associate degrees and career training. Nearby Morehead State University and Marshall University (in West Virginia) are also within a reasonable commuting distance for bachelor's and advanced degrees. Transportation & Connectivity
Vance boasts excellent connectivity for a community of its size. Its primary artery is U.S. Route 60 (the historic Midland Trail), which provides a direct and efficient route into downtown Ashland and to Interstate 64. I-64 is a major east-west corridor, connecting residents to Huntington, West Virginia, in about 30 minutes and to Lexington, Kentucky, in approximately two hours. This makes Vance ideal for commuters working in Ashland, Huntington, or even the larger Tri-State industrial and business centers.
For air travel, the Huntington Tri-State Airport (HTS) is the closest commercial airport, located just across the river in West Virginia and offering several daily flights to major hubs. The area is primarily car-dependent, as is typical for rural and suburban Kentucky, with straightforward road networks and minimal traffic congestion.
